@import"https://fonts.googleapis.com/css2?family=Poppins:wght@300;400;600&display=swap";body.header-fixed .pageWrapper__header__wrap{position:fixed;top:0;left:0;width:100%;transition:all .5s ease;backface-visibility:hidden;will-change:transform}body .pageWrapper__header{font-family:"Poppins",sans-serif}body .pageWrapper__header__wrap{background-color:#fff;box-shadow:0 3px 6px 0 rgba(0,0,0,.16);position:relative;transition:background-color .3s ease;z-index:998}body.header-transparent .pageWrapper__header__wrap{background-color:rgba(0,0,0,0);box-shadow:none}body.header-fixed.header-transparent .pageWrapper__header__wrap{background-color:#fff;box-shadow:0 3px 6px 0 rgba(0,0,0,.16)}body .pageWrapper__header__wrap__container{padding:0.625rem 0.9375rem;box-sizing:border-box;display:flex;justify-content:space-between;align-items:flex-start}body .pageWrapper__header__menu{padding-top:0.1875rem}body .pageWrapper__header__menu .hover-border{display:none}body .pageWrapper__header__menu button{border:none;cursor:pointer;background:none}body .pageWrapper__header__menu button#menu-button{display:flex;z-index:999;position:relative;align-items:center;justify-content:center;background-color:#00385d;border-radius:50%;width:3.0625rem;height:auto;text-align:center;aspect-ratio:1/1;transition:all .2s ease}body .pageWrapper__header__menu button#menu-button.open .pageWrapper__header__menu__mobile__line-top{top:0.5625rem;-khtml-transform:rotate(45deg);transform:rotate(45deg)}body .pageWrapper__header__menu button#menu-button.open .pageWrapper__header__menu__mobile__line-middle{filter:alpha(opacity=0);-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=0)";-webkit-opacity:0;-khtml-opacity:0;-moz-opacity:0;-ms-opacity:0;-o-opacity:0;opacity:0}body .pageWrapper__header__menu button#menu-button.open .pageWrapper__header__menu__mobile__line-bottom{bottom:0.5rem;-khtml-transform:rotate(-45deg);transform:rotate(-45deg)}body .pageWrapper__header__menu__mobile{position:relative;height:1.1875rem;width:1.625rem}body .pageWrapper__header__menu__mobile__line{display:block;transition:all .3s ease;width:1.625rem;height:0.125rem;background:#fff}body .pageWrapper__header__menu__mobile__line-top,body .pageWrapper__header__menu__mobile__line-bottom{position:absolute;transition-duration:.3s .3s;left:0}body .pageWrapper__header__menu__mobile__line-top{transition-property:top,transform;top:0}body .pageWrapper__header__menu__mobile__line-middle{margin:0.5rem 0;opacity:1}body .pageWrapper__header__menu__mobile__line-bottom{transition-property:bottom,transform;bottom:0}body .pageWrapper__header__logo{order:2;width:calc(100% - 10rem);z-index:998;display:flex;justify-content:center}body .pageWrapper__header__logo svg{max-width:100%;max-height:3.875rem}body .pageWrapper__header .logo,body .pageWrapper__header a{width:100%;margin:0 auto;position:relative;z-index:101;display:flex;align-items:center;justify-content:center}body .pageWrapper__header .logo{flex-direction:column;height:3.4375rem}body .pageWrapper__header .logo.has-slogan{height:4.375rem}body .pageWrapper__header .logo a{color:#000;height:100%}body .pageWrapper__header .logo>p{font-size:0.75rem;line-height:1.2;text-align:center;margin:0.375rem 0 0.1875rem;display:block}body .pageWrapper__header .logo svg{max-width:100%}body .pageWrapper__header__additionnallinks{display:flex;align-items:center;order:3;position:relative;z-index:998;width:3.4375rem}body .pageWrapper__header__additionnallinks .langage-selector{display:none}body .pageWrapper__header__additionnallinks .btn-icon{color:#099ddc}body .pageWrapper__header__additionnallinks .btn-icon svg{width:1.6875rem;height:1.6875rem}body .pageWrapper__header__additionnallinks .btn-icon:hover{background-color:#099ddc;color:#fff}#primary-nav{height:100%;box-sizing:border-box;position:relative}#primary-nav .menu{background:#fff;transition:visibility .2s ease,opacity .3s ease,transform .3s ease;visibility:hidden;padding:5rem 1.25rem 1.25rem;box-sizing:border-box;height:var(--app-height, 100vh);width:100%;position:fixed;z-index:99;opacity:0;top:0;left:0;overflow:hidden;pointer-events:none}#primary-nav .menu.open{visibility:visible;pointer-events:auto;opacity:1;top:0;z-index:997;box-shadow:0 0.1875rem 0.375rem 0 rgba(0,0,0,.16)}#primary-nav .menu ul{padding:1.875rem 0 0}#primary-nav .menu ul:before{position:relative;top:-0.625rem}#primary-nav .menu ul:after{position:absolute;bottom:0}#primary-nav .menu>ul{overflow-y:scroll;overflow-x:hidden;height:auto;width:100%;display:flex;flex-direction:column;row-gap:0.25rem}#primary-nav .menu>ul:not(:first-child){padding:0}#primary-nav .menu>ul li{display:flex;flex-direction:row;align-items:center;-moz-column-gap:0.25rem;column-gap:0.25rem}#primary-nav .menu>ul li.menu-logo-item{display:none}#primary-nav .menu>ul li.menu-item-parent{padding-bottom:0.625rem;margin-bottom:1.25rem;position:relative}#primary-nav .menu>ul li.menu-item-parent button.prev-menu-toggle{padding:0;width:1.875rem;height:1.875rem;text-align:left;color:#000;transition:all .2s ease}#primary-nav .menu>ul li.menu-item-parent button.prev-menu-toggle svg{width:1.25rem;height:1.25rem}#primary-nav .menu>ul li.menu-item-parent button.prev-menu-toggle:hover{color:#099ddc}#primary-nav .menu>ul li.menu-item-parent .item a,#primary-nav .menu>ul li.menu-item-parent .item p{font-size:1.25rem;font-weight:500;color:#00385d;padding:0}#primary-nav .menu>ul li.menu-item-parent .item p{margin:0}#primary-nav .menu>ul li.menu-item-parent .item a:hover{color:#099ddc}#primary-nav .menu>ul li.menu-item-has-children{justify-content:space-between}#primary-nav .menu>ul li.menu-item-has-children>.item{width:100%;display:flex;justify-content:space-between}#primary-nav .menu>ul li.menu-item-has-children>.item>a{width:calc(100% - 1.875rem)}#primary-nav .menu>ul li.menu-item-has-children>.item:hover>a{color:#00385d}#primary-nav .menu>ul li.menu-item-has-children>.item:hover>button.sub-menu-toggle{color:#099ddc}#primary-nav .menu>ul li.menu-item-has-children button.sub-menu-toggle{width:1.875rem;height:1.875rem;text-align:right;color:#000;transition:all .2s ease}#primary-nav .menu>ul li.menu-item-has-children button.sub-menu-toggle svg{width:1.25rem;height:1.25rem}#primary-nav .menu>ul li.menu-item-has-children button.sub-menu-toggle:hover{color:#099ddc}#primary-nav .menu>ul li.menu-item-has-children>.sub-menu{display:none;opacity:0;transform:translateX(100%);background:#fff;transition:all 0s ease;height:calc(var(--height, 100%) - 6.0625rem);padding:6.875rem 1.25rem 1.25rem}#primary-nav .menu>ul li.menu-item-has-children>.sub-menu[aria-hidden=false]{display:block;transform:translateX(0);opacity:1;width:100%;height:var(--height);position:absolute;top:0;left:0;z-index:999;transition:all .2s ease}#primary-nav .menu>ul li .item a{cursor:pointer;font-size:1rem;color:#00385d;transition:all .2s ease;padding:0.625rem 0;display:block;font-weight:500}#primary-nav .menu>ul li .item a:hover{color:#099ddc}a.btn-icon,button.btn-icon{box-shadow:0 0 0.625rem 0 rgba(0,0,0,.16);background-color:#fff;transition:all .3s ease;height:3.4375rem;width:3.4375rem;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#00385d}a.btn-icon svg,button.btn-icon svg{height:1.375rem;width:1.375rem}a.btn-icon:hover,button.btn-icon:hover{background-color:#099ddc;color:#fff}body .gform_wrapper .gform_fields,body .gform_wrapper .gform_footer{--gf-ctrl-btn-bg-color-primary: #00385d;--gf-ctrl-btn-bg-color-hover-primary:#099ddc;--gf-local-border-color:#00385d;--gf-ctrl-btn-border-color-hover-primary:#fff;--gf-ctrl-btn-color-hover-primary:#fff;--gf-ctrl-btn-border-color-focus-primary:#00385d;--gf-ctrl-btn-bg-color-focus-primary:#00385d;--gf-ctrl-border-color-focus:#fff;--gf-ctrl-outline-color-focus:#00385d;--gf-ctrl-choice-check-color:#00385d;--gf-local-padding-x:20px;--gf-ctrl-label-font-family-primary: "Raleway";--gf-ctrl-btn-radius: 1.875rem;--gf-ctrl-btn-text-transform: uppercase}body .gform_wrapper .gform_fields{--gf-form-gap-y: 0.9375rem}body .gform_wrapper .gform_fields .gfield label{--gf-ctrl-label-color-primary: #000000;--gf-ctrl-label-font-weight-primary: 400;cursor:pointer}body .gform_wrapper .gform_fields .gfield .ginput_container input[type=text]{transition:all .2s ease}body .gform_wrapper .gform_fields .gfield .ginput_container input[type=text]::-moz-placeholder{color:#000000}body .gform_wrapper .gform_fields .gfield .ginput_container input[type=text]::placeholder{color:#000000}body .gform_wrapper .gform_heading .gform_required_legend{display:none}body .gform_wrapper .gform_footer{justify-content:center;--gf-form-footer-margin-y-start: 0.9375rem}body{font-family:"Poppins",sans-serif}body.menu-open{overflow:hidden}body.menu-open:after{content:"";position:fixed;left:0;z-index:98;width:100%;height:100vh;top:0;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px)}body .pageLayout__breadcrumbs{padding:0.4375rem 0.9375rem}body .pageLayout__breadcrumbs #breadcrumbs{justify-content:center;font-family:"Poppins",sans-serif}body .pageLayout__breadcrumbs #breadcrumbs ul{display:flex;flex-wrap:wrap;justify-content:flex-start;padding:0;list-style-type:none;-moz-column-gap:0.5625rem;column-gap:0.5625rem;margin:0;color:#00385d}body .pageLayout__breadcrumbs #breadcrumbs ul li a{color:#00385d;transition:all .2s ease;text-decoration:none}body .pageLayout__breadcrumbs #breadcrumbs ul li a:hover{color:#099ddc}body .pageLayout__breadcrumbs #breadcrumbs ul li a,body .pageLayout__breadcrumbs #breadcrumbs ul li span{text-transform:uppercase;font-size:0.75rem;font-weight:500}body .pageLayout__breadcrumbs #breadcrumbs ul li span{color:#00385d}.icon__set{position:absolute;width:0;height:0;overflow:hidden}.icon{display:inline-block;vertical-align:middle;fill:currentColor;pointer-events:none}@media screen and (min-width: 62em){body .pageWrapper__header__wrap__container{align-items:center}body .pageWrapper__header__logo{width:calc(100% - 25rem)}body .pageWrapper__header .logo.has-slogan{height:5rem}body .pageWrapper__header .logo>p{font-size:0.875rem;margin:0.6875rem 0 0.1875rem}body .pageWrapper__header__menu{width:12.5rem}body .pageWrapper__header__additionnallinks{justify-content:flex-end;width:12.5rem}body .pageWrapper__header__additionnallinks .btn-arrow{flex-direction:row;row-gap:0;font-size:0.875rem;text-align:left}}@media screen and (min-width: 64em){body.home:not(.header-fixed) .pageWrapper__header__wrap{background:none;box-shadow:none}body.home:not(.header-fixed) .pageWrapper__header__additionnallinks .btn-icon{box-shadow:0 0 0.625rem 0 rgba(0,0,0,.16);background-color:rgba(0,0,0,0);color:#fff}body.home:not(.header-fixed) .pageWrapper__header__additionnallinks .btn-icon:hover{color:#fff;background-color:#00385d}body.home:not(.header-fixed) .pageWrapper__header #primary-nav .menu>ul li a{color:#fff}body.home:not(.header-fixed) .pageWrapper__header #primary-nav .menu>ul li a:hover{color:#00385d}body.home:not(.header-fixed) .pageWrapper__header__logo .logo{height:7.5rem}body.home.header-fixed{padding-top:0 !important}body.home.header-fixed .pageWrapper__header__wrap:before{opacity:1;transform:scaleX(1)}body.home.header-fixed .pageWrapper__header__logo .logo:before{opacity:0;transform:translateY(-2.5rem)}body.home .pageWrapper__header{position:absolute;width:100%;top:0}body.home .pageWrapper__header__wrap:before{content:"";height:100%;width:100%;position:absolute;z-index:-1;background-color:#fff;opacity:0;transform-origin:center;transition:opacity .5s ease,transform .4s ease;transform:scaleX(0)}body.home .pageWrapper__header__logo .logo{position:relative}body.home .pageWrapper__header__logo .logo:before{content:"";position:absolute;top:-0.625rem;left:0;height:calc(100% + 1.875rem);transition:opacity .4s ease,transform .5s ease;transform:translateY(0);width:100%;z-index:-1;opacity:1;background-color:#fff;border-bottom-left-radius:1.25rem;border-bottom-right-radius:1.25rem}body.home:not(.header-fixed) .pageWrapper__header__wrap__container{height:7.5rem}body.home:not(.header-fixed) .pageWrapper__header__logo svg{max-height:5.625rem}body .pageWrapper__header__wrap__container{position:relative}body .pageWrapper__header__logo{position:absolute;top:50%;left:50%;transform:translate(-50%, -50%);width:18rem}body .pageWrapper__header__menu{width:100%;padding-right:5.3125rem}body .pageWrapper__header__menu .hover-border{position:absolute;top:calc(100% - 0.5625rem);height:0.125rem;transition:all .2s ease;background-color:#000;pointer-events:none;opacity:0;z-index:10}body .pageWrapper__header__additionnallinks{width:3.4375rem;position:absolute;right:0.9375rem;top:50%;transform:translateY(-50%)}body .pageWrapper__header button#menu-button{display:none}#primary-nav .menu{opacity:1;visibility:visible;position:relative;height:auto;background:rgba(0,0,0,0);padding:0;box-shadow:none !important;pointer-events:auto;display:flex;justify-content:space-between}#primary-nav .menu>ul{overflow:auto;padding:0;flex-direction:row;-moz-column-gap:1.0625rem;column-gap:1.0625rem}#primary-nav .menu>ul#top_menu{justify-content:flex-start;width:calc(50% - 10rem)}#primary-nav .menu>ul#secondary_menu{width:calc(50% - 12rem);justify-content:flex-end}}@media screen and (min-width: 68.75em){#primary-nav .menu{overflow:visible}#primary-nav .menu>ul{-moz-column-gap:1.875rem;column-gap:1.875rem;overflow:visible}#primary-nav .menu>ul li.menu-item-parent{display:none}#primary-nav .menu>ul li.menu-item-has-children{position:relative}#primary-nav .menu>ul li.menu-item-has-children button.sub-menu-toggle{display:none}#primary-nav .menu>ul li.menu-item-has-children>.item>a{width:auto}#primary-nav .menu>ul li.menu-item-has-children:hover .sub-menu[aria-hidden=false],#primary-nav .menu>ul li.menu-item-has-children:hover .sub-menu[aria-hidden=true]{opacity:1;visibility:visible;transition:all .11s ease;display:block}#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=false],#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=true]{position:absolute;width:-moz-max-content;width:max-content;left:50%;top:100%;transform:translateX(-50%);padding:0.3125rem 1.25rem;visibility:hidden;height:auto;transition:top .2 ease,opacity .2s ease,visibility .2s ease}#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=false]>.menu-item,#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=true]>.menu-item{padding:0.375rem 0}#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=false]>.menu-item>.item a:hover,#primary-nav .menu>ul li.menu-item-has-children .sub-menu[aria-hidden=true]>.menu-item>.item a:hover{color:#099ddc}}@media screen and (min-width: 75em){body .pageWrapper__header__wrap__container{padding:1rem 0.9375rem 1.1875rem;max-width:84.375rem;margin:0 auto}body .pageLayout__breadcrumbs{max-width:97.75rem;margin:0 auto}}@media screen and (min-width: 78.75em){body .pageWrapper__header__logo{width:25rem}#primary-nav .menu>ul#secondary_menu{width:calc(50% - 15rem)}}